My NUT said that at about 6 months, i could do corn on the cob. Simply because corn is hard to digest. i'v had corn not on the cob though, and i figure, that's pretty much the same, and i did fine eating it. Granted i didn't eat a whole lot of it, but still i didn't have any issues with it. How far out are you?

I made some high Protein veggie chili (added in lots of black lentils and some Textured Vegetable Protein) - and I added one can of corn to a 6 quart batch. I have had absolutely no problems with it. I am 8 weeks (2 months) out, and the doctor just told me yesterday I could start integrating in some semi-firm veggies and fruits - I would assume that corn falls into that category. Just like anything else, stick to YOUR doctors recommendations, and whenever you try something new, go slowly, eat a small amount, and try new foods at home in case you have a reaction!!

I was cleared for all foods by my doc and NUT at 8 weeks. I tried corn on the cob at 9 weeks, and did fine. It was so delicious. I have had it three times in the last month. I can eat 1 very small ear, but then chose to have just a half ear the other times to be sure to have room to get my Protein in. One half ear was very satisfying. Remember, it is a starch, so count the carbs in your daily totals.

This is something you will have to be careful about. Half ear. Not often. Self-discipline.
